东方程序猿怎么看西方同行?印、日、中、韩各种吐槽
[来源:] 2012-09-25 11:24:00 编辑:唐尤华 点击: 次
你想过,东方程序员怎么看西方的同行吗?这个问题被网友在StackExchange上发帖问了出来:
在我看来,东方的程序员如何看待西方同行是一个有趣并且重要的问题。通常认为东方国家(印度/中国/菲律宾)是为西方国家提供外包服务(美国
在我看来,东方的程序员如何看待西方同行是一个有趣并且重要的问题。通常认为东方国家(印度/中国/菲律宾)是为西方国家提供外包服务(美国
你想过,东方程序员怎么看西方的同行吗?这个问题被网友在StackExchange上发帖问了出来:
在我看来,东方的程序员如何看待西方同行是一个有趣并且重要的问题。通常认为东方国家(印度/中国/菲律宾)是为西方国家提供外包服务(美国和欧洲)的。你有过参与离岸开发的经历吗?如果有,你对此有何看法?对于西方程序员你有哪些总印象吗(比如是否具有协作精神,是否按时交付产品,或者他们的工作质量如何)?
伯乐在线的唐尤华翻译了这篇文章:
以下是来自东方各国程序员的答案:
一、印度程序员
Danish
身为印度人,我想谈谈印度程序员。
我觉得问题在于这里的文化,也就是人们的思维模式。自孩提时代开始,我们就被训练如何遵照流程循规蹈矩,然后进入类似工程、医学、商业管理等高薪职业。创新、探索和创业在印度并不常见。
大多数人进入IT行业是为了挣钱,而不是因为他们爱好编程或是喜欢计算机领域。由于缺乏兴趣,我们中的大多数人会成为编程机器,只会执行指令而不关心它们的含义。大多数开发者从不以终端用户的角度思考问题,也不会思考他们开发的模块会为更大的系统提供怎样的价值。
在印度你很难找到发明家,但是你会发现很多优秀的工人。在这里成长就意味着收入的增加和地位的提升,知识在这里一文不值。
即使IT的领军企业也是如此。他们从学院里招聘毕业生并把他们训练成机器人。最悲哀的莫过于,他们的薪资相对其他行业而言相对较高,因此没有人愿意从这些公司离开。在印度,几乎没有IT公司会招聘真正有才能的人。
另外一个重要的因素是,大多数有才能的人都远渡重洋去美国或其他国家,在那里他们能够施展自己的才华并赚到比印度同行更多的收入。所以,如果你是一位印度开发者,只有成为流程专家而不是技术新秀才有机会成功。
尽管现在开始有所变化,我们能够看到涌现出一些初创企业,但是仍然为数很少。
二、日本程序员
Rei Miyasaka
我来自日本。
我并不认为日本程序员真正理解西方人在一半于我们的时间里做的那些工作。我们生活在自己那个小小的加拉帕戈斯泡沫中(与全球化隔绝),对世界上其他的事情置若罔闻。撇开科学软件不谈(仿真系统、开发工具等等),我不认为我们对学术充满热情。在日本我们将软件看成硬件的奴隶,所以创新往往出现在硬件领域。
所以,当比尔盖茨说“软件是创新的源泉”这样的话时,大多数日本人只会认为“啊,他很富有,他知道自己在说些什么”,然后接着回去不加思考地设计应用程序。
与此同时,不论我们是否意识到了这一点,对外国人的憎恶和迫害情结已经深深地扎根于日本社会。Tron项目(一个开发性实时操作系统内核项目)的成员就是这样的例子,尽管我希望他们是非常极端的情况:
非常不幸,在散布流言的人中有日本人。这些日本人,包括其他参与散布TRON项目谣言的外国人应该更加清楚地知道,他们忽略了这样一个事实:TRON不是一个短期的商业项目,不应该以2到3年内占领某个特定市场作为评价其成功的标准。
不幸的是,这不能打消一些日本人的看法。他们真的相信微软会为匿名黑客攻击Sony的行为提供WinMoible7手机作为奖励。(也许付钱是有可能的,但是为什么他们要提供并非昂贵的手机给这些黑客呢??)
据说日本程序员似乎对可用性和UI非常感兴趣——因此可以经常看到,来自日本的UI尽管摆脱了传统,但是非常方便、直观。这一点甚至在Ruby设计风格中有所体现:
Matsumot(Ruby语言的发明者)设计的目标就是为了提高程序员效率的同时为他们带来乐趣,这一点遵循了优秀用户界面的设计原则。他强调说,系统设计需要更加关注人而不是机器,……
如果我的愤世嫉俗让你感到吃惊,我在这里还有更多的阐述。
三、巴基斯坦程序员
Armir
我来自巴基斯坦。我工作7年了。大多数时间里,我和美国的同事一起工作。我参与过的工作有:
• 离岸外包
• 美国公司在巴基斯坦的分支机构
这里我想分享一下我的感受。美国的同事非常坦诚也喜欢坦诚(因为只有和美国同事合作的经验,所以不好对其他国家的人进行评价)。这里我想说的是如果下周要完成某个任务,主要开发者因为各种原因需要请假,大多数情况下我会告诉美国的同事,他们会认真把请假的情况认真考虑。
然而在巴基斯坦,一般人的心理是即使自己不能完成也要试图让对方满意。他们试图把本地团队可能影响到生意的想法隐藏起来,我认为这种做法是错误的。一个现实的例子是,我最近从一个非常重要的团队协调员位置离职了,这个职位的工作就是协调海外团队和本地团队的工作。在我离职的时候,海外团队的经理在通知本地团队的时候,也通知了谁是我的继任者。但是,仅仅在我离职15天之后,我的下一任也离职了。这一次,他们没有告知本地团队并且把我继任者离职的消息封锁了起来,现在应该是别的什么人来接任这个位置。
所有这些通常都是为了避免对商业关系产生不好的影响,这一类的事情在巴基斯坦非常常见。
因此,一般对西方和西方团队的看法是,虽然比起我们没有绝对的技术优势,但他们需要高质量的工作。第二点也是非常重要的一点,他们需要诚实的工作。如果事情变糟糕,告诉他们真实的情况。毕竟,他们不会派出CIA的侦探来跟踪我们 。
-
APP江湖的未来
APP的成败,或许根本不应该有ISP思
- APP江湖的未来
- 看看移动捅下的这个窟窿有
- 富士康:低利润的组装业务如
- 华为重提上市,能走多远?
- 三星业绩创历史新高,而焦虑
- 为什么说亚马逊收购Zynga
- 美国正在发生什么新产业革
-
三星业绩创历史新
10月5日,韩国三星电子公司公布的数据显示,该公司第三季...
- 三星业绩创历史新高,而焦虑感却在
- 乔布斯:我想在那儿多种一些杏树
- 沃尔玛已经翻脸了,亚马逊还有多少
- 看看移动捅下的这个窟窿有多大!
- APP江湖的未来
- 苹果与谷歌争什么?大数据!
- 为什么说亚马逊收购Zynga是可行
- 来看看都有哪些中国互联网公司是